Most common organs involved in wegner’s granulomatosis are

Correct Answer: Lung and kidney
Description: Wegner gronulomatosis now known as, granulomatosis with polyangitis is a necrotizing vasculitis characterized by a tried of. Necrotizing gronulomar of the upper respiratory tract (ear, nose, sinuses, throat) or the lower respiratory tract (lung) or both. Necrotizing or granulomatous vasculitis affecting small to medium - sized vessels (eg: capillorics, venuler, arterioles and arterier). Most prominent in the lungs and upper airways but involving other sites as wells. Focal necrotizing, often crescentic, glomerulonephritis Also know that "limited" forms of this disease may be restricted to the respirotory tract,
